Resetting a Password
A forgotten password is the most common snag, and it is a quick fix. Select the reset link on the login screen, and a secure link goes to your registered email. Follow it, set a new password, and sign back in. If the email is slow to arrive, check the spam folder before requesting a second one, since multiple requests can cancel each other out.
Two-Factor Authentication
Two-factor is optional but strongly worth enabling. Once on, each login adds a one-time code from your authenticator or phone, so a leaked password alone will not open the account. The setup lives in the account security menu and takes a minute.
The password is the lock most people rely on, and it is the weakest one. Two-factor is the deadbolt, and switching it on is the difference between a guessed password being an inconvenience and being a disaster.

Staying Signed In Safely
A login is only as safe as the habits around it, and a handful of small ones make a real difference. Use a password unique to this casino rather than one recycled from another site, since a leak elsewhere is the most common way an account is opened by someone who should not. Switch on two-factor so a password by itself is never enough.
And keep the recovery email current and secure, because it is the key that resets everything else. On your own device, staying signed in is fine and convenient; on a shared or borrowed phone, sign out at the end, since a session left open is an open door to the balance.
When Two-Factor Saves You
It is worth being concrete about why two-factor matters, because it is easy to skip. Passwords leak constantly, usually through no fault of the player, when another site is breached and a reused password is tried everywhere. Two-factor breaks that chain: even with the right password, an attacker cannot produce the one-time code, so the account stays shut.
The setup takes a minute in the security menu, and the only housekeeping is to move the authenticator or keep the backup codes if you change phones. For the small effort, it removes the single most common way casino accounts are compromised, which is why enabling it is the first thing worth doing after registering.
